Of all your five senses only one has direct access to your neocortex. The olfactory nerve, which conveys the sense of smell, directly connects to your frontal lobe (the executive function area in the thinking part of your brain). It is also intimately involved with your limbic system (the area responsible for emotions and memory formation).
